> +Freescale i.MX7 Media Video Device
> +==================================
> +
> +mipi_csi2 node
> +--------------
> +
> +This is the device node for the MIPI CSI-2 receiver core in i.MX7 SoC. It is
> +compatible with previous version of Samsung D-phy.
> +
> +Required properties:
> +
> +- compatible    : "fsl,imx7-mipi-csi2";
> +- reg           : base address and length of the register set for the device;
> +- interrupts    : should contain MIPI CSIS interrupt;
> +- clocks        : list of clock specifiers, see
> +        Documentation/devicetree/bindings/clock/clock-bindings.txt for details;
> +- clock-names   : must contain "pclk", "wrap" and "phy" entries, matching
> +                  entries in the clock property;
> +- power-domains : a phandle to the power domain, see
> +          Documentation/devicetree/bindings/power/power_domain.txt for details.
> +- reset-names   : should include following entry "mrst";
> +- resets        : a list of phandle, should contain reset entry of
> +                  reset-names;
> +- phy-supply    : from the generic phy bindings, a phandle to a regulator that
> +	          provides power to MIPI CSIS core;
> +- bus-width     : maximum number of data lanes supported (SoC specific);
> +
> +Optional properties:
> +
> +- clock-frequency : The IP's main (system bus) clock frequency in Hz, default
> +		    value when this property is not specified is 166 MHz;

Could this be obtained from one of the clock inputs via clk_get_rate?
